The Importance of a Driver's License


A driver's license serves multiple functions, consisting of:

  1. Proof of Identity: A driver's license is frequently considered as among the most valid kinds of recognition.

  2. Legal Authorization: It grants individuals consent to operate a motor automobile, guaranteeing compliance with state and federal policies.

  3. Insurance coverage Necessity: Many vehicle insurance suppliers require drivers to possess a valid license to obtain coverage.

  4. Convenience: A driver's license enhances mobility, allowing individuals to commute easily without counting on public transport.

Important Documents to Prepare

To facilitate the application procedure, individuals should collect the required documents ahead of time. Commonly needed files include:

  1. Proof of Identity: This might consist of a birth certificate, passport, or government-issued ID.

  2. Proof of Residency: An utility costs, lease contract, or bank declaration may suffice.

  3. Social Security Number: It might be required to produce a Social Security card or a file showing the number.

  4. Adult Consent (if relevant): For applicants under 18, a moms and dad or guardian's signature might be required.

Frequently asked questions About Obtaining a Driver's License


1. What is Express Driving License to get a learner's permit?

The majority of states allow people to look for a student's authorization at the age of 15 or 16, depending upon particular state laws.

2. Can I obtain a driver's license without a learner's authorization?

No, in a lot of states, a student's permit is a requirement for a full driver's license, permitting new drivers to practice under supervision.

3. How long is a driver's license legitimate?

Driver's licenses generally remain valid for 4 to 8 years, depending upon the state. Renewal procedures might vary.

4. What happens if I stop working the driving test?

If you stop working the driving test, you are typically allowed to reschedule for another attempt after an established waiting period. Ensure to examine feedback from the inspector to improve your abilities.

5. Do I need insurance to get a driver's license?

While insurance coverage is not constantly a requirement to obtain a license, it is compulsory to have car insurance coverage before driving lawfully on public roads.
